COLLEGE BASKETBALL: ATHENS GRAD BABCOCK POSTS BACK-TO-BACK DOUBLE-DOUBLES (UPDATE ON ATHENS GRAD LANE) (2024-01-12)

Valley Sports Report
ELMIRA - Athens grad J.J. Babcock, a sophomore on the Elmira College men’s basketball team, has posted back-to-back double-doubles for the Soaring Eagles.

Athens grad Aaron Lane, a junior who transferred to Elmira from Keuka College, has played in each of the Eagles’ games since Christmas break ended.

On Saturday, Babcock knocked down 8 of 12 shots from the field, including a 3-pointer, to match his season-high with 20 points in a 108-95 loss to St. John Fisher. He also hauled down 13 rebounds, including six off the offensive glass, to go along with three assists, and two steals in 30 minutes of action.

Lane knocked down his only shot of the game, and finished with two points and one rebounds in four minutes of action.

On Tuesday, Babcock had 11 points, 12 rebounds, three assists, and five blocked shots in a 27 minutes in a 77-75 win over Houghton College.

On the season, Babcock has started 10 of the 11 games he’s played in, and has averaged 25.4 minutes per game. He averages 11.9 points, 7.5 rebounds, and 2.6 assists. He also has 10 blocked shots, nine steals, and six 3-pointers, and is shooting 47.7 percent from the field.

Lane has averaged 6.1 minutes per game in eight games this season. He averages 2.6 points,1 rebound, and 1 assist per game. His season-high is seven points, which he’s done twice this season.

Elmira College, now 5-8, returns to action tonight at Russell Sage College.
